Although the pandemic affected most of the global population and production, it left a significant impact on a few particular industries. Although some global markets flourished, including pharmaceuticals, healthcare, and online shopping, they were a handful, considering most of the international markets nearly collapsed. Sales and profitability took a nosedive as these sectors faced extensive restraints due to broken supply chains, restricted logistic conditions, lack of trade, and reduced consumer spending.

Travelling and tourism were probably the most impacted international markets. Because the seas and skies closed, there were sanctions on tourism due to covid’19 outspread. So, everything related to tourism and travelling, including hospitality businesses, souvenir industries, local guides, and tour markets, deteriorated.
Lockdowns and decreased outdoor gatherings meant people did not require public- or private transportation services. In addition, limited tourism further caused a restraint on the overall transportation demands. Moreover, even after covid reopening, people would rather buy their own cars instead of using public transportation or transport services. These factors were significant enough to cause even the automobile and accessories sectors to suffer substantially.

With concerts, sports competitions, bars, and other public spaces avoided by most, it’s sufficient to say that the pandemic profoundly damaged the global leisure industry.
Although the music industry didn’t suffer that much, the movie industry, on the other hand, had a tremendous impact. Outdoor restrictions, personnel safety, and growing diseases meant the production of several movies and series was put temporarily on hold. In addition, with movie theatres closed, profitability concerns further acted as constraints. Fortunately, now, with the cinemas and theatres back in action, the international sector can be expected to reach newer milestones very soon.
The self-employment and personal service sector suffered critically because demand for laundry, residential and commercial cleaning and salons was almost zero- especially during the first few months of covid’19 outspread. Being home meant people doing the chores by themselves, and stringent lockdowns meant most physical businesses closed till outdoor activities resumed. And even then, health and germ concerns have made several households avoid hiring such services.
In short, one trend can be observed quite evidently. Jobs and industries dealing more with interactive jobs and people-closeness suffered the most. That’s because of several reasons like lockdowns, limited social and outdoor activities, and the rising fear of germ contagiousness.
As individuals worried about growing diseases and health concerns, personal interactions ceased for some time. Though, they’re just barely starting to reinitiate even if most of the international population still prioritises minimising human interactions as much as possible.
